Output 582435a54470c80a0043aed02ca5d8d456b9acb68fd8c40a1d0144e655182d3e:2

value
3900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 383026016aea04149c85d01dbfcbe5a91173083f OP_EQUALVERIFY OP_CHECKSIG
address
1686XA46cfQHhYxWN94vDE22BienZKMCQ1
transaction
582435a54470c80a0043aed02ca5d8d456b9acb68fd8c40a1d0144e655182d3e
spent
true